Results

Pickering-Scarborough East
Party Candidate Votes Status
213/213 polls Updated: May. 3, 2011 3:40 AM EDT
CON Corneliu Chisu 19,220 Elected
LIB Dan McTeague 18,053
NDP Andrea Moffat 8,972
GRN Kevin Smith 1,746

Riding Info

Download riding map (PDF). Link opens in a new window.

This fast-growing Toronto area riding contains part of the former city of Scarborough and part of Pickering.

It runs from Lake Ontario in the south to Finch Avenue and Finch Avenue East in the north, between Valley Farm Road, Highway 401 and Brock Road in the east and Meadowvale Road, Sheppard Avenue East, Morningside Avenue and Highland Creek in the west.

The Pickering-Scarborough East riding was created in 2004 from 44 per cent of Pickering-Ajax-Uxbridge, 40 per cent of Scarborough East and a small area from Scarborough-Rouge River. Pickering-Ajax-Uxbridge was created in 1986 from parts of the former Ontario riding and Durham riding.

Population: 106,602 (2006 census; a decrease of 0.1% since 2001)

Political History

In 2008, Liberal Dan McTeague won his sixth term with 49 per cent of the vote, beating Conservative George Khouri.

McTeague won in 2006, acquiring 52 per cent of the vote and defeating Conservative Tim Dobson.

McTeague also won with 57 per cent of the vote in the previous election and defeated the Alliance's Ken Giffith in Pickering-Ajax-Uxbridge in 2000.

Conservative Michael Starr represented the old Ontario riding from a 1952 byelection through to 1968, when Liberal Norm Cafik took over as MP for three terms. PC Scott Fennell held the riding from 1979 to 1988, when PC René Soetens won one term.

Scarborough East elected Conservatives in 1972 and from 1979 to 1984 and Liberals in 1968 and 1974. In 1993, Liberal Doug Peters, who served as secretary of state for international financial institutions, was elected. Liberal John McKay won two terms in Scarborough East in 1997 and 2000.
